/**	@file dk3bf.h Header file for the dk3bf module.
*/

#ifndef DK3BF_H_INCLUDED
/** Avoid multiple inclusions. */
#define DK3BF_H_INCLUDED 1


#line 8 "dk3bf.ctr"

#include "dk3conf.h"
#include "dk3types.h"

#ifdef __cplusplus
extern "C" {
#endif


/**	Open a bit field (bit array).
	@param	nbits	Number of bits.
	@param	app	Application structure for diagnostics, may be NULL.
	@return	Pointer to new bit field on success, NULL on error.
*/
dk3_bf_t *
dk3bf_open_app(size_t nbits, dk3_app_t *app);

/**	Close bit field.
	@param	b	Bit field to close.
*/
void
dk3bf_close(dk3_bf_t *b);

/**	Set or reset one bit.
	@param	b	Bit field.
	@param	n	Index of bit to set.
	@param	v	New bit value (1 or 0).
*/
void
dk3bf_set(dk3_bf_t *b, size_t n, int v);

/**	Get one bit value.
	@param	b	Bit field.
	@param	n	Index of bit.
	@return	1 or 0 depending on the bit value.
*/
int
dk3bf_get(dk3_bf_t const *b, size_t n);

/**	Open a bit matrix.
	@param	x	Number of columns.
	@param	y	Number of rows.
	@param	app	Application structure for diagnostics, may be NULL.
	@return	Pointer to new bit matrix on success, NULL on error.
*/
dk3_bm_t *
dk3bm_open(size_t x, size_t y, dk3_app_t *app);

/**	Close bit matrix.
	@param	b	Bit matrix to close.
*/
void
dk3bm_close(dk3_bm_t *b);

/**	Set cache size (threshold to switch between traditional
	algorithm for dk3bm_expand and cache friendly algorithm).
	@param	b	Bit matrix.
	@param	cs	Maximum matrix size for traditional algorithm.
*/
void
dk3bm_set_cache_size(dk3_bm_t *b, size_t cs);

/**	Set or reset  one bit.
	@param	b	Bit matrix.
	@param	x	Column number.
	@param	y	Row number.
	@param	v	New value for bit.
*/
void
dk3bm_set(dk3_bm_t *b, size_t x, size_t y, int v);

/**	Get one bit.
	@param	b	Bit matrix.
	@param	x	Column number.
	@param	y	Row number.
	@return	1 or 0 depending on the bit value.
*/
int
dk3bm_get(dk3_bm_t const *b, size_t x, size_t y);

/**	Expand bit matrix. The matrix must be square.
	@param	b	Bit matrix.
*/
void
dk3bm_expand(dk3_bm_t *b);


#ifdef __cplusplus
}
#endif




#endif
